Game Description
Set in the heart of the ancient Mayan civilization, MayanEmpire challenges players to build and expand their territories while navigating the complex socio-political landscape of the time. Unlike other strategy games, MayanEmpire places a strong emphasis on cultural development and resource management, making it essential for players to balance warfare with diplomacy and innovation.
The game world is a vivid tapestry of lush jungles, towering pyramids, and bustling marketplaces, all meticulously rendered to immerse players in the essence of the Mayan era. From the start, players are tasked with leading a fledgling city-state, transforming it into the dominant empire through strategic alliances, trade, and conquests.
Core Gameplay Mechanics
At its core, MayanEmpire revolves around several key mechanics that set it apart:
Resource Management
Players must efficiently harvest resources such as maize, jade, and obsidian, each essential for the growth and prosperity of their empire. Resource scarcity is a constant challenge, requiring players to make strategic decisions about trade and territorial expansion.
Cultural Development
Cultural progress is vital in MayanEmpire. Players are encouraged to invest in arts and sciences, developing unique traits and technologies that provide critical advantages over rivals. Festivals, religious ceremonies, and monumental architecture projects are some ways players can enhance their cultural influence.
Diplomatic Strategy
Unlike typical conquest-focused games, MayanEmpire rewards diplomacy and alliance-building. Neighboring city-states and tribes offer opportunities for collaboration, yet also pose potential threats. Players can negotiate treaties, forge partnerships, or wage war, with each choice impacting their empire's standing in the world.
Conflict and Warfare
While peace is desirable, conflict is often unavoidable. Players must build and maintain a formidable army, capable of defending and expanding their territories. The game features a unique combat system that emphasizes tactical planning and unit positioning, rather than brute force.
Rules and Objectives
The main objective in MayanEmpire is to establish your city-state as the supreme power within the game world. Players compete to achieve milestones that reflect their empire's growth and influence, including:
- Constructing Great Wonders: Building grand structures like the Temple of Kukulkan boosts prestige and offers game-changing benefits.
- Forming Alliances: Forge alliances with other players and AI-controlled factions to strengthen your empire's position.
- Advancing Technology: Progress through various technology trees that enhance military, economic, and cultural capabilities.
- Exercising Diplomacy: Successfully negotiate peace or extract concessions from opponents to secure your empire's future.
- Expanding Territory: Conquer or peacefully assimilate neighboring regions to access new resources and opportunities.
The game features a dynamic turn-based system, where decisions impact the unfolding narrative and create a unique experience for each player. Success requires foresight, adaptability, and a keen understanding of the evolving challenges within the game.
